As far as a colorado and silverado, they are 2 completely different trucks.  Different frame, motor, tranny, etc...  I dont think they share anything other than the fact they are both pick up trucks.  Needless to say the colorado, is a very nice compact pick up especially for your first car.  Good Luck on your test.
